CAMP4’s funding influx paves the way for tapping regulatory RNA to treat urea cycle disorders

Pharmaceutical Technology

Last week, CAMP4 Therapeutics announced the close of a $100 million Series B round , which will be used to advance their regulatory RNA (regRNA)-focused programs. CAMP4’s CSO David Bumcrot PhD tells Pharmaceutical Technology that the company plans to see clinical trials go forward for their urea cycle disorder programs late next year.

Shape Therapeutics-Roche’s Deal; AllStripes Raises $50M; Datavant-Real Chemistry’s Partnership; BlueWillow’s Nasal Vaccine

Delveinsight

Seattle biotech firm Shape Therapeutics has signed a deal potentially exceeding USD 3 billion with pharma giant Roche to bolster the development of gene therapies for Alzheimer’s and Parkinson’s disease. Shape’s RNA editing technologies can modify the RNA sequence, which makes the body’s protein building blocks.

Generating Over a Billion Cells with CRISPR for Next Generation Cell Therapies

XTalks

CRISPR technology has begun to enter clinical trials due to emerging therapeutic applications, but the technology still has limitations, primarily because it is difficult to safely make large quantities of precisely edited cells. The results demonstrate potential as a novel, safe and effective approach to cell therapies.
